LPCM File Format: An In-Depth Look
LPCM, or Linear Pulse Code Modulation, is a method of digital audio encoding that represents audio signals in a linear format. It is widely regarded as one of the most straightforward and high-fidelity methods of audio representation, making it a popular choice for both professional and consumer audio applications.
Common Uses
LPCM is predominantly utilized in various audio and video formats, including CDs, DVDs, and Blu-ray discs, where it serves as the primary audio format. Its uncompressed nature ensures that audio quality is preserved, making it ideal for applications that require high fidelity, such as music production, film scoring, and broadcasting. Additionally, LPCM is frequently used in digital audio workstations (DAWs) and other audio editing software to maintain the integrity of audio during recording and editing processes.
Because LPCM remains uncompressed, it can result in larger file sizes compared to compressed formats like MP3 or AAC. However, for audio professionals and enthusiasts who prioritize quality, the trade-off is well worth it, as LPCM allows for greater detail and dynamic range. This makes it the preferred choice for archiving audio recordings and for use in high-end audio playback systems.
History
The history of LPCM dates back to the early days of digital audio technology. The concept of Pulse Code Modulation (PCM) was introduced in the 1930s, but it wasn’t until the 1960s that LPCM began to gain traction, particularly with the advent of digital recording techniques. The format became standard for audio CDs introduced in 1982, which popularized LPCM as a reliable means of representing high-quality audio.
As technology advanced, LPCM continued to evolve and adapt, finding its place in newer media formats like DVDs and digital audio streaming. The format’s compatibility with various audio systems has allowed it to remain relevant in a rapidly changing digital landscape.
